Congratulations to Sachit Khosla for joining our Tech Industry Gold Class of 2020! Sachit completed a Tech Industry Gold digital degree apprenticeship, studying at the University of East London and working at Accenture. Find out more about Sachit’s experience.
Name:Â Sachit Khosla
University:Â University of East London
Degree Title: BSc (Honours) in Digital & Technology Solutions
Classification: 1st Class honours
Title of Dissertation: ‘Headless Commerce – The New Era’
Employer: Accenture
Job Title: Application Developer

What was the most challenging experience of your Tech Industry Gold degree apprenticeship?
The challenging part about a tech degree is that sometimes the code you write to make your application might work locally but some parts could fail when you try and host it. So, finding workarounds for that was a challenge.
A challenging part of a degree apprenticeship is to be able to manage your time between work and university properly. Being able to do this was quite challenging but fun without a doubt.Â

What would you say to anyone considering a Tech Industry Gold degree apprenticeship?
My advice to anyone studying a tech degree is to keep going. Technology is an area where you require a lot of patience. When programming an application, you will encounter multiple occasions where your code may not work even though everything is correct. At this point, the best thing to do is to actually think about what you are doing versus what you are trying to do and if everything is still correct, then find a way around the problem but don’t give up! The journey of a tech degree is exciting and full of learning opportunities.
